Customer Success Manager in Worcester

Customer Success Manager in Worcester

Worcester Full-Time No home office possible
D

At DCS Group, we’re the UK’s leading Distributor, Manufacturer and Exporter of Health, Beauty, Household and Grocery products, proudly partnering with global power brands such as Procter & Gamble, Unilever, Kenvue, PZ Cussons, SC Johnson, Whitworths and Danone.

We’re now seeking a Customer Success Manager – Manufacturing to drive profitable growth, strengthen customer partnerships, and lead end-to-end commercial delivery across our manufacturing division. Reporting to the Channel Lead – Manufacturing, you’ll play a pivotal role in securing new opportunities, elevating customer satisfaction, and supporting the successful delivery of innovative, market-leading products.

What You’ll Do

  • Own commercial delivery across your customer portfolio, achieving agreed revenue and margin targets.
  • Create, manage, and submit accurate commercial proposals and tender responses, working collaboratively with Commercial Finance.
  • Assess customer product briefs for commercial feasibility and launch viability.
  • Provide high-level technical and product support to customers.
  • Identify and target key customer contacts, building strong multi-stakeholder relationships.
  • Strengthen customer retention by building long-term value and exit barriers.
  • Maximise profitability through effective demand qualification, forecasting, and timescale management.
  • Identify, qualify and convert new business and network opportunities.
  • Build strong industry relationships to secure new client wins.
  • Deliver collaborative end-to-end project management with internal and external teams.
  • Pitch trend-led, data-driven product innovations to strategic partners.
  • Conduct category reviews, market monitoring and trend analysis to support growth.

What We’re Looking For

  • Proven experience in new business development and customer management.
  • Strong commercial acumen with the ability to understand and act on customer needs.
  • Excellent communication, relationship-building and influencing skills.
  • Technical understanding of manufacturing and production processes.
  • Ability to interpret and present data with confidence.
  • Strong Personal Care category understanding (desired).
  • Ability to problem-solve, identify challenges and propose effective solutions.
  • Degree-level education or equivalent experience in Manufacturing / Project Management.

Why Join DCS Group?

At DCS, we’re proud of our dynamic, fast-paced, and people-first culture. You’ll join a collaborative team in a business that invests in development, encourages innovation and supports long-term career progression.

We offer a great range of benefits including:

  • Life Cover
  • Pension
  • Medical Cash Plan
  • Cycle to Work Scheme
  • Well-being initiatives
  • Staff shop
  • Regular social events

Join us and help shape the future of manufacturing excellence at DCS Group.

D

Contact Detail:

DCS Group (UK) Ltd Recruiting Team

Customer Success Manager in Worcester
DCS Group (UK) Ltd
Location: Worcester

Land your dream job quicker with Premium

You’re marked as a top applicant with our partner companies
Individual CV and cover letter feedback including tailoring to specific job roles
Be among the first applications for new jobs with our AI application
1:1 support and career advice from our career coaches
Go Premium

Money-back if you don't land a job in 6-months

D
Similar positions in other companies
UK’s top job board for Gen Z
discover-jobs-cta
Discover now
>